Output 525f19ed8fc6079fecf2e5c6ed6696ad12b75ca3c79b0396aff5fb4d962a9ee8:3

value
2921010107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 632532fab8e757747a0e1bdadb9ee97da529afa1 OP_EQUALVERIFY OP_CHECKSIG
address
1A3ETdhDybCY7yqtuG2xa3DiMWdfcheU7S
transaction
525f19ed8fc6079fecf2e5c6ed6696ad12b75ca3c79b0396aff5fb4d962a9ee8
spent
true